The Ukraine Photodiode Sensors Market is experiencing steady growth driven by increasing demand across various industries such as automotive, healthcare, and electronics. The market is witnessing a rise in the adoption of photodiode sensors for applications including light detection, distance measurement, and optical communication. Key players in the market are focusing on product innovation and technological advancements to cater to the evolving needs of customers. The growing emphasis on automation and IoT technologies is further fueling the demand for photodiode sensors in Ukraine. Additionally, government initiatives to promote the development of the electronics industry in the country are expected to contribute to the market`s growth. Overall, the Ukraine Photodiode Sensors Market presents lucrative opportunities for manufacturers and suppliers in the coming years.

In the Ukraine Photodiode Sensors Market, some of the key challenges faced include intense competition from global players offering similar products at lower prices, limited awareness and adoption of advanced sensor technologies among local industries, and the impact of geopolitical factors on market stability. Additionally, the lack of adequate infrastructure and investment in research and development activities within the country pose challenges for domestic sensor manufacturers to innovate and stay competitive in the market. Moreover, regulatory hurdles and trade restrictions can hinder market growth and market entry for new players, further complicating the business environment for photodiode sensor manufacturers in Ukraine. Overcoming these challenges will require strategic partnerships, technology collaborations, and targeted marketing efforts to educate and attract potential customers towards adopting photodiode sensor technologies.
